Bessent Says US to Press Ahead in Iran War With Hormuz in Sights

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ent said US-Israeli attacks on Iran are aimed at destroying its fortifications along the Strait of Hormuz while Iranian leaders face a Monday deadline from President Donald Trump to reopen the waterway.

WHAT THIS MEANS
The reported escalation of US-Israeli military actions against Iran, targeting the Strait of Hormuz, could disrupt global oil supplies and lead to higher energy prices, potentially increasing inflation and market volatility. This geopolitical tension might prompt investors to shift towards safe-haven assets, negatively impacting equities and riskier investments in the short term. However, if the market has already anticipated such conflicts, the actual financial impact could be limited.
